Niklas Saers wrote: > > Has anyone had any success with installing IBM's DB2 for Linux on FreeBSD? > It's freely available as a beta release from IBM, who even sends you the CD > upon request. :) > DB2 installs fine, but fails to create groups and accounts for the first instance (or something).
